An In-Depth Look at the Private Transfer Experience

When you’re planning a trip from The Hague to Schiphol Airport, timing and convenience often top the list of priorities. This private transfer service offers a pretty stress-free way to get there without the hassle of taxis, public transport, or arranging multiple rides. The journey takes roughly 35 to 50 minutes, depending on traffic, which means you’ll have plenty of time to relax or prep for your flight.

The Booking and Confirmation Process
Booking is straightforward and can be arranged in advance—on average, travelers book about 23 days ahead of their trip. Once booked, you receive a mobile ticket, which makes the process smooth and contactless. The confirmation is immediate, giving you peace of mind knowing your transfer is secured. The service is flexible in terms of cancellation—cancel up to 24 hours beforehand for a full refund, making it easier to adapt if your plans change.
Meet and Greet at Schiphol
The driver will meet you at the designated arrival point: Aankomstpassage 1, Schiphol Airport. This central spot is convenient, especially if you’re arriving from another flight or train. The driver will communicate their location clearly, which is helpful after a long journey when you’re tired or disoriented.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is the transfer private?
Yes, this is a private transfer, meaning only your group will participate, ensuring a more relaxed and personalized experience.
What is included in the price?
The fee covers the private vehicle, professional driver, and a water bottle. Pickup from your specified location and drop-off at the airport are also included.
How far in advance should I book?
Most travelers book about 23 days before their trip, but you can reserve sooner or closer to your travel date depending on availability.
What if my flight is delayed?
The service offers flexible booking, but it’s best to communicate your flight details clearly when booking. Since the service is private, your driver can adjust if they are informed about delays.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ours before the scheduled pickup.
Where exactly does the driver meet you at Schiphol?
The meeting point is at Aankomstpassage 1, Schiphol Airport, a convenient and central location for arrivals.
Is this suitable if I have mobility concerns?
While the vehicle is modern and comfortable, the driver drops you at the beginning of the airport, which might require walking. If mobility is a concern, plan accordingly or request specific drop-off instructions.
Are there any hidden costs?
No, the price listed is final for up to three people. Additional costs are unlikely unless specified separately.
